Reports: UniCredit CEO Backs Takeover Of Commerzbank

Recent media reports indicate that UniCredit CEO Andrea Orcel has expressed support for a potential merger between UniCredit (UCG, UNCFF.PK) and Commerzbank (CRZBY.PK). Orcel believes that such a merger could generate added value for shareholders, emphasizing that the ultimate decision rests with the shareholders themselves.

Previously, UniCredit acquired approximately a 9% equity stake in Commerzbank AG. The bank announced plans to engage with Commerzbank to explore opportunities that could create value for all stakeholders involved. Notably, it was revealed last week that Commerzbank AG’s CEO, Manfred Knof, will not seek an extension of his contract.

Commerzbank holds a leading position in serving the German Mittelstand and is a strong partner for around 25,500 corporate client groups and nearly 11 million private and small-business customers in Germany. On the other hand, UniCredit is a pan-European commercial bank offering unique services across Italy, Germany, and Central and Eastern Europe.
